Subscription / Continuity Model

A recurring-billing sales model common to supplements and coaching that draws heightened chargeback scrutiny.

A subscription billing model charges a customer automatically on a recurring schedule rather than once per purchase. It produces predictable revenue, and it produces a distinct dispute profile that underwriting looks at closely.

Recurring charges generate disputes in ways one-off sales do not. A customer who forgets they subscribed, cannot find how to cancel, or does not recognise the descriptor on their statement will often call their bank rather than you. Those become chargebacks, and the ratio is what puts an account into a monitoring program.

The controls that reduce this are unglamorous and effective: a descriptor customers recognise, a renewal reminder before charging, cancellation that takes as few steps as signup, and prompt refunds when someone genuinely forgot. Each removes disputes before they reach the issuer.

Involuntary churn is the other half. Cards expire and get reissued, so a share of renewals fail for reasons unrelated to intent. A sensible retry approach and keeping saved credentials current recover much of that revenue, but retries need to be paced, because aggressive repeated attempts against a declining card are themselves a risk signal.
